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a connector for floor iron plate with a simple structure, at a low cost and capable of bringing adjoining iron plates into contact with each other and connecting them with a single member easily, so as to secure passage of vehicles and safety of walking and to prevent mud and dirt.SOLUTION: In a connector for floor iron plate, ends of contact parts in linearly adjoining floor iron plates are fitted to the connector in a direction orthogonal to the adjacent direction so that the adjoining floor iron plates are connected with each other. In the connector, a metal skeleton in U-shaped cross section is covered with a rubber coating, and an upper part, a lower part and a side part for connecting the upper and lower parts are formed while a space in which the ends of the floor iron plates are inserted is formed between the upper and lower parts, and the height of the space is equivalent to or less than the thickness of the floor iron plate.

本発明は、建設、工事現場等の床面、路面に敷設され、仮設道路を形成する敷鉄板同士の連結具に関する。 TECHNICAL FIELD The present invention relates to a connecting tool for laying iron plates that are laid on a floor surface or road surface of construction, a construction site, or the like and form a temporary road.

従来、建設、工事現場等への車両、歩行での往来を容易にし、かつ泥汚れを防止するため、舗装されていない通路には砂利を敷き詰めて仮設道路を形成していた。しかし、砂利の購入、敷設、砂利の撤去は煩雑で、費用がかかるものであった。   Conventionally, in order to make it easy to go to and from construction, construction sites, etc. by walking and to prevent mud dirt, gravel is spread over unpaved passages to form temporary roads. However, gravel purchase, laying, and gravel removal were cumbersome and expensive.

そのため、昨今では敷鉄板を敷き詰め、通行の安全および泥汚れ防止の観点から鉄板同士を溶接して仮設道路としている。しかしながら、敷鉄板は再利用されるため、工事終了後には鉄板同士の溶接部を研磨する必要があった。その研磨は、煩雑で、費用がかかるものであった。   Therefore, in recent years, iron plates are laid down, and iron plates are welded to form a temporary road from the viewpoint of traffic safety and prevention of mud dirt. However, since the laid iron plate is reused, it is necessary to polish the welded portion between the iron plates after the completion of the construction. The polishing was cumbersome and expensive.

そこで、敷鉄板同士を溶接することなく、連結する手段が提案されている。例えば、特許文献1には、溶接することなく敷鉄板どうしを連結でき、連結される敷鉄板の端面間に隙間が形成されない敷鉄板の連結具が公開されている。また、特許文献2には、建設現場における構内の仮設道路に用いる敷き鉄板上に荷重が掛かった時、敷鉄板相互に段差が生ぜず、段差に起因する作業員の転倒を無くせるようにし、また敷き鉄板の敷設及び撤去作業も容易で現場作業効率を確実に向上させることができる建設現場の仮設敷鉄板路及び接合治具が公開されている。   Then, the means to connect without laying iron plates is welded is proposed. For example, Patent Literature 1 discloses a laying iron plate connector in which laying iron plates can be connected to each other without welding, and no gap is formed between end surfaces of the laying iron plates to be connected. In addition, in Patent Document 2, when a load is applied on the laying iron plate used for the temporary road on the premises at the construction site, no step is generated between the laying iron plates, so that the fall of the worker due to the step can be eliminated. In addition, a temporary laying iron plate path and a joining jig on the construction site that can easily lay and remove the laying iron plate and reliably improve the work efficiency on the site are disclosed.

特開2003−268710号公報JP 2003-268710 A 実登3012923号公報Noto 3012923 gazette

しかしながら、特許文献1、2では、いずれも連結具を固定するための他の手段(楔材、固定ビス)を必要としていた。また、特許文献1では敷鉄板に加工(ネジ孔の穿設)をする必要がある。他方、特許文献2では隣接する鉄板同士に隙間があり、雨天では雨水とともに泥が鉄板上に浮き上がってきて、車両、公道、作業者等が汚れ、清掃の手間が発生してしまう。   However, Patent Documents 1 and 2 both require other means (wedge material, fixing screw) for fixing the coupler. Moreover, in patent document 1, it is necessary to process (drilling a screw hole) to a laying iron plate. On the other hand, in Patent Document 2, there is a gap between adjacent iron plates, and in rainy weather, mud floats on the iron plate together with rainwater, so that vehicles, public roads, workers, etc. become dirty, and cleaning work is generated.

そこで、本発明は、簡易な構造、低廉で、かつ1の部材で簡単に隣接する鉄板同士を当接して連結し、車両の通行及び歩行の安全を確保するとともに泥に汚れを防ぐ敷鉄板の連結具を提供することを目的とする。   Therefore, the present invention provides a simple structure, low cost, and easy installation of the iron plate that makes it possible to contact and connect adjacent steel plates with a single member to ensure the safety of traffic and walking of the vehicle and to prevent dirt from dirt. An object is to provide a connector.

図2は、本発明である敷鉄板の連結具の一例の模式図である。図2(A)は正面からの斜視図、図2(B)はA−A線の断面図である。   FIG. 2 is a schematic view of an example of a connecting iron plate connector according to the present invention. 2A is a perspective view from the front, and FIG. 2B is a cross-sectional view taken along the line AA.

敷鉄板の連結具1は、図2に示すように、断面コの字状の金属製の骨格2をゴム被覆3で覆って、敷鉄板上に位置することとなる上部1aと敷鉄板下に位置することとなる下部1bと上下部1a、1bを連結し敷鉄板の側面に当接することとなる側部1cとを形成する。その結果、上下部1a、1bの間に敷鉄板の端部を挿入するスペース4が形成される。そして、スペース4の高さ5は、敷鉄板の厚さ以下とする。   As shown in FIG. 2, the laying iron plate connector 1 is formed by covering a metal skeleton 2 having a U-shaped cross section with a rubber coating 3 and under the upper laying plate and the upper laying plate located on the laying iron plate. The lower part 1b to be positioned and the upper and lower parts 1a and 1b are connected to form a side part 1c that comes into contact with the side surface of the laid iron plate. As a result, a space 4 is formed between the upper and lower parts 1a, 1b for inserting the end of the laid iron plate. And the height 5 of the space 4 shall be below the thickness of a laid iron plate.

敷鉄板は、種々の大きさ、厚さのものが流通されている。特に、工事現場等の車両通路では、縦約6m、横1.5m、厚さは22mmが一般に使用されている。この規格であれば、1.6トンの重量に耐えることができる。   There are various sizes and thicknesses of laid iron plates. In particular, a vehicle passage such as a construction site generally has a length of about 6 m, a width of 1.5 m, and a thickness of 22 mm. This standard can withstand a weight of 1.6 tons.

例えば、厚さ22mmの敷鉄板であれば、スペース4の高さ5は、22mm以下、好ましくは20mm以下である。   For example, in the case of a covered iron plate having a thickness of 22 mm, the height 5 of the space 4 is 22 mm or less, preferably 20 mm or less.

骨格2としては、金属製、例えば、鉄、ステンレス、その他合金で硬度が高いものが好ましい。ゴム被覆3の素材としては、弾性がある既存のゴム製品が使用でき、ゴム被覆3にはシリコンなどの弾性体も含むものとする。適宜硬化剤を添加して、スペース4と着脱性、抜け防止の観点から所望の硬さに調節するとよい。敷鉄板から敷鉄板の連結具の使用中の抜け防止のため、スペース4側面のゴム被覆3には、先端に向けテーパー状の楔形の突起を複数設けてもよい。   The skeleton 2 is preferably made of metal, such as iron, stainless steel, and other alloys having high hardness. As a material of the rubber coating 3, an existing rubber product having elasticity can be used, and the rubber coating 3 includes an elastic body such as silicon. A curing agent may be added as appropriate to adjust the hardness to a desired level from the viewpoints of space 4, detachability, and prevention of disconnection. A plurality of tapered wedge-shaped protrusions may be provided on the rubber coating 3 on the side surface of the space 4 toward the tip in order to prevent the cover iron plate from coming off during use of the connecting iron plate connector.

骨格2の厚さは、鉄であれば、全域均一で、2.5〜3.5mm、好ましくは3.0mm前後でよい。ゴム被覆3の厚さは、5.0mm前後が好ましい。金属製の骨格2を採用することで、全てゴムで連結具を成形した場合より、強度があるとともに、コストを低く抑えることができる。他方、ゴム被覆3を採用することで、弾性体であるため敷鉄板より狭いスペース4であっても敷鉄板の連結具1を敷鉄板に嵌めることができるとともに、摩擦抵抗で敷鉄板から連結具の抜けを防ぐ効果がある。   The thickness of the skeleton 2 may be uniform over the entire region of iron, and may be 2.5 to 3.5 mm, preferably around 3.0 mm. The thickness of the rubber coating 3 is preferably around 5.0 mm. By adopting the metal skeleton 2, the strength can be reduced and the cost can be reduced compared to the case where the connector is entirely formed of rubber. On the other hand, by adopting the rubber coating 3, since it is an elastic body, it is possible to fit the laying iron plate connector 1 to the laying iron plate even in a space 4 narrower than the laying iron plate. There is an effect to prevent omission.

上部1a、下部1bのスペース4方向の奥行きは、70〜100mm、80mm前後あれば、敷鉄板上を通行する車両の振動等による、敷鉄板の上下方向の歪み、横ずれにも十分耐えることができる。奥行きに直交する横方向の長さは敷鉄板の大きさにより適宜変更できる。例えば、敷鉄板の大きさが約6m×4mの場合であれば、200〜300mm、より好ましくは200mm前後でよい。   If the depth in the space 4 direction of the upper part 1a and the lower part 1b is around 70 to 100 mm and 80 mm, it can sufficiently withstand vertical distortion and lateral displacement of the ironing board due to vibrations of a vehicle passing on the ironing board. . The length in the horizontal direction perpendicular to the depth can be changed as appropriate depending on the size of the laid iron plate. For example, when the size of the laid iron plate is about 6 m × 4 m, it may be 200 to 300 mm, more preferably around 200 mm.

また、上部1aの敷鉄板上に位置することとなる端部は、ゴム被覆3を先端に向けテーパー状の傾斜部6を形成するとよい。傾斜部がなだらかほど、敷鉄板の連結具1に車両が乗り上げても衝撃がすくなく、通行人がつまずくことがなくなり、通行の不快感が低減されるとともに安全性が高まる。   Moreover, it is good for the edge part located on the laying iron plate of the upper part 1a to form the taper-shaped inclination part 6 with the rubber coating 3 facing the front-end | tip. The gentler the sloping portion, the less impact is generated even when the vehicle rides on the laying iron plate connector 1, and the passerby does not trip, reducing the discomfort of traffic and increasing the safety.

スペース4側の上部1a、下部1bのゴム被覆の挿入方向端部に、切欠き1d、1eを形成することで、敷鉄板の連結具1を敷鉄板に嵌めやすくなる。   By forming the notches 1d and 1e at the end portions of the rubber coating in the upper part 1a and the lower part 1b on the space 4 side, it becomes easy to fit the laying iron plate connector 1 to the laying iron plate.
